The National Park Service plans to issue a solicitation for the construction of a 30 by 40-foot Cypress pavilion with a metal roof on a concrete slab at the Andersonville National Historic Site in Georgia. This project is specifically set aside for small business firms classified under NAICS code 236220, related to commercial and institutional building construction, with a small business size standard of $45 million. The contract is expected to be firm-fixed-price and will adhere to Davis-Bacon prevailing wage requirements for Sumpter County, Georgia. Only one formal site visit will be allowed, and the solicitation, along with all relevant documents, will be available for download on SAM.gov, approximately starting March 27, 2026. Interested small businesses must have an active vendor record in SAM.gov, be eligible under the specified NAICS code, and have no federal exclusions such as debarment or delinquent debt. The government intends to award one contract based on the most advantageous offer considering price and other factors. Offers will be due roughly 30 days after solicitation issuance, and all questions after issuance must be submitted in writing by the stated deadline. The notice is informational and does not obligate the government to release a solicitation or make an award. Additional information will only be provided once the solicitation is officially released.
